targeting engagers.•Presented encouraging preclinical data for INB-619, a CD19-targeting γδ T cell engager for oncology and autoimmune diseases. The data showed complete B cell depletion, robust γδ T cell expansion, and minimal CRS-associated cytokine release (IL-6, TNF-α), reinforcing the platform’s differentiation and therapeutic potential.•Progressing INB-619 into IND-enabling studies, with initial animal data expected in 2026
